🦞
Integración de Canal

Conectar OpenClaw a WhatsApp

La forma más popular de usar OpenClaw (anteriormente Moltbot). Chatea con tu asistente de IA directamente en WhatsApp.

💬 Por qué WhatsApp es el Mejor Canal
  • Siempre ContigoWhatsApp ya está en tu teléfono
  • Mensajes de VozEnvía notas de voz, OpenClaw transcribe y responde
  • Análisis de ImágenesEnvía fotos para que la IA analice
  • Interfaz NaturalSe siente como enviar mensajes a un amigo
⚠️ Importante: API de WhatsApp Business

OpenClaw usa el protocolo no oficial de WhatsApp Web. Esto significa:

  • Necesitas vincular un número de teléfono (como WhatsApp Web)
  • Se usa tu cuenta de WhatsApp existente
  • WhatsApp puede cambiar su protocolo sin aviso
  • Para uso comercial, considera la API oficial de WhatsApp Business

Pasos de Configuración

1

Habilitar WhatsApp en la Configuración

Añade la configuración de WhatsApp a tu archivo de configuración de OpenClaw:

{
  "channels": {
    "whatsapp": {
      "enabled": true,
      "allowFrom": ["+1234567890"]
    }
  }
}

Reemplaza con los números de teléfono permitidos para enviar mensajes a tu bot

2

Reiniciar OpenClaw

Reinicia para aplicar la configuración de WhatsApp:

openclaw restart
3

Escanear Código QR

Un código QR aparecerá en el panel de OpenClaw o en la terminal. Escanéalo con WhatsApp:

  • Abre WhatsApp en tu teléfono
  • Ve a Configuración -> Dispositivos Vinculados
  • Toca "Vincular un Dispositivo"
  • Escanea el código QR mostrado por OpenClaw
4

Empezar a Chatear

Una vez vinculado, envíate un mensaje desde otro dispositivo, o pide a un amigo que envíe un mensaje al número vinculado. OpenClaw responderá a los mensajes de los números en tu lista allowFrom.

Configuración Avanzada
{
  "channels": {
    "whatsapp": {
      "enabled": true,
      "allowFrom": ["+1234567890", "+0987654321"],
      "allowGroups": false,
      "autoRead": true,
      "typingIndicator": true,
      "reactionEmoji": "🦞"
    }
  }
}
  • allowFromNúmeros de teléfono que pueden enviar mensajes (con código de país)
  • allowGroupsHabilitar respuestas en chats grupales
  • autoReadMarcar mensajes como leídos automáticamente
  • typingIndicatorMostrar "escribiendo..." mientras procesa
  • reactionEmojiReaccionar a los mensajes cuando se reciben
Consejos Pro
💡Usa un número de teléfono secundarioConsigue una SIM barata o usa Google Voice para tu bot
💡Los mensajes de voz funcionan muy bienOpenClaw transcribe el audio y responde en texto
💡Envía imágenes para análisisCapturas de pantalla, recibos, documentos - OpenClaw puede leerlos
⚠️ Solución de Problemas

¿Código QR expirado?

Los códigos QR expiran después de unos minutos. Reinicia OpenClaw para generar uno nuevo.

¿La conexión se cae constantemente?

Mantén el teléfono vinculado conectado a internet. WhatsApp Web requiere que el teléfono esté en línea periódicamente.

¿El bot no responde a ciertas personas?

Asegúrate de que su número de teléfono (con + y código de país) esté en el array allowFrom.

¡WhatsApp Conectado!

Explora más canales o personaliza tu asistente de IA con skills.